Tree Removal Costs - The typical cost for removing a small tree in Desoto, TX, ranges from $200 to $500, depending on size and complexity. Larger trees can cost between $700 and $2,000 or more. Prices vary based on accessibility and tree height.
stump Grinding Expenses - Stump grinding services usually cost between $75 and $300 per stump, with larger stumps incurring higher fees. The cost depends on stump size and depth of the root system. Additional charges may apply for multiple stumps.
Cost Factors - Factors influencing costs include tree size, location, and proximity to structures. Removal of trees near power lines or buildings can increase the price, sometimes exceeding typical ranges. Extra services like hauling away debris may also add to the total.
Service Area Variations - Costs in Desoto, TX, and nearby areas can vary based on local contractor rates. Some providers may include additional fees for difficult terrain or restricted access. Contact local service providers for precise estimates tailored to specific tree removal need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
